Niko’s Auto Repair
Niko's Auto Repair is a NYS licensed automotive repair facility and inspection station. We are a one-stop-shop to facilitate all your vehicle's needs. We are also available for your towing and roadside service needs all day every day.
-
Monday-Friday 8:00-5:00.
24 Hour Towing
10am - 3pm
-
(607) 290-4048
-
173 Rockland Road
Roscoe, NY 12776